    Efficacy of Cetirizine Combined with Budesonide on Children with Bronchial Asthma and its Effects on Levels of Serum TGF-β1, MCP-1 and SDF-1

    • OBJECTIVE To study the effects of cetirizine combined with budesonide(BUN) on treatment and levels of serum transforming growth factor-β1(TGF-β1), monocyte chemoattractant protein-1(MCP-1) and stromal-derived factor-1(SDF-1) in children with bronchial asthma. METHODS Ninety four cases of children with acute episode of asthma were randomly and evenly divided into observation group(cetirizine combined with BUN, n=47) and control group(BUN, n=47), and they were treated for 7 d. The treatment effects, clinical symptoms, pulmonary function indexes and levels of serum TGF-β1, MCP-1 and SDF-1 were compared between the two groups. RESULTS The effective rate of treatment in observation group and control group were 95.74% and 82.98% respectively(P<0.05). The disappearance times of signs of cough, asthmatic symptoms, wheezing and wet rales in observation group were less than those in control group(P<0.05). After treatment, the forced expiratory volume in 1 second(FEV1), the percentage of FEV1 in predicted value(FEV1%) and peak expiratory flow(PEF) were significantly increased in the two groups(P<0.05), and the levels of FEV1, FEV1% and PEF in observation group were higher than those in control group(P<0.05). After treatment, the levels of serum TGF-β1, MCP-1 and SDF-1 were significantly decreased in the two groups(P<0.05), and the levels in observation group were lower than those in control group(P<0.05). CONCLUSION Cetirizine combined with BUN for asthmatic children can effectively reduce the expression levels of serum TGF-β1, MCP-1 and SDF-1, and relieve the respiratory tract inflammation, thereby improving the symptoms and treatment effects.
